Orlando Benefit Brings Pulse Performers To Nashville

Performers and management from Pulse Night Club traveled to the Music City to attend a fundraiser at Play Dance Bar.

The benefit Wednesday, put on by Play and Nashville Pride, raised money for those affected by the terror attack.

Performances took place throughout the night by local LGBT performers and guests from the Pulse Night Club.

Pulse manager Nemma Bahrami said he was thankful for the support.

“We just want to thank everybody for the love because it's overwhelming - it really is. And you never know what people think and right now all I can think is positive because everyone is just giving us positive love and that's amazing,” said Bahrami.

All the funds from the event benefited the employees and victims of the Pulse Night Club massacre.
